Hacks für den Firefox
Meiner Meinung nach sollte man bevor man den Firefox hackt seinen Websitecode auf XHTML-Konformität prüfen. Denn aus meiner Sicht ist der Firefox der "Saubermann" unter den Browsern!
Sollte die Prüfung des XHTML-Codes kein befriedigentes Ergebnis bringen, so habe ich hier ein paar brauchbare Firefoxhacks.
- alle Firefox-Versionen:
- CSS-Kommentarzeichen:
Diese mit den entsprechenden Kommentarzeichen versehenen Hacks werden in die CSS-Datei unterhalb der entsprechenden allgemeinen Anweisung eingefügt, da sie ansonsten von der eigentlichen und vom Firefox verständlichen allgemeinen Anweisung überschrieben und bleibt wirkungslos.
Für alle Firefox-Versionen:
1 #selector[id=selector] { width:350px; }
Für alle Firefox-Versionen:
1 @-moz-document url-präfix() { .selector { width:350px; } }
Für alle Gecko einschliesslich allen Firefox
1 *>.selector { width:350px; }
- Firefox-Versionen 1.5 und neuer:
- CSS-Kommentarzeichen:
1 .selector, x: -moz-any-link, x: only-child { width:350px; }
- Firefox-Versionen 2.0 und älter:
- CSS-Kommentarzeichen:
1. Möglichkeit:
1 body:empty .selector {width:350px; }
2. Möglichkeit:
1 #selector[id=SELECTOR] { width:350px; }
3. Möglichkeit:
1 html>/**/body .selector, x: -moz-any-link { width:350px; }
- Firefox-Version 3.X:
Mit dem folgenden Hack kann man zielgenau den Firefox 3.X ansprechen:
- CSS-Kommentarzeichen:
1 html>/**/body .selector, x: -moz-any-link x:default { width:350px; }
